91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

如何評估在Java中使用SIMD的效果

小樊
81
2024-08-15 13:27:40
欄目: 編程語言

在Java中使用SIMD(Single Instruction, Multiple Data)指令集可以通過以下方式來評估其效果:

  1. 性能比較:比較使用SIMD指令集和不使用SIMD指令集的代碼的性能差異。可以使用性能分析工具(如JMH)來進行測試和對比。

  2. 內存訪問模式:SIMD指令集可以通過同時處理多個數據元素來提高內存訪問效率。通過分析數據訪問模式和內存訪問帶寬來評估SIMD的效果。

  3. 算法復雜度:評估算法的復雜度對SIMD效果的影響。某些算法可能更適合使用SIMD指令集,而某些算法可能無法從SIMD中獲益。

  4. SIMD優化:對代碼進行SIMD優化,包括數據對齊、數據重排和向量化等技術。評估優化后的代碼性能提升情況。

  5. 硬件支持:評估硬件對SIMD指令集的支持情況,包括處理器的SIMD指令集支持程度和性能。

綜上所述,評估在Java中使用SIMD的效果需要綜合考慮性能比較、內存訪問模式、算法復雜度、SIMD優化和硬件支持等因素。通過細致的分析和測試,可以更好地評估SIMD在Java中的效果和適用性。

0
新疆| 延川县| 壤塘县| 玉门市| 巨鹿县| 陵川县| 济阳县| 平顶山市| 府谷县| 青田县| 金寨县| 西和县| 安宁市| 扬中市| 白朗县| 高尔夫| 弋阳县| 晴隆县| 沙雅县| 永济市| 永定县| 古浪县| 津南区| 大宁县| 牙克石市| 闵行区| 郴州市| 滨州市| 启东市| 新建县| 成安县| 邯郸县| 凤庆县| 聂荣县| 阳西县| 余江县| 环江| 平利县| 苏尼特左旗| 磐石市| 井研县|